it's on the MegaDrive. Because most tv's in Europe only supported Pal 50hz back in the day, a lot of games released on the European Megadrive got the music slowed down when it was being adjusted from NTSC 60hz (US and Japanese TV standards).
Some companies, like SEGA, ensured big games like Sonic 3 had the music played at the same speed no matter where it was released. but not every company did that.
